SIXTH AMENDMENT TO FINANCING AGREEMENT
AND FORBEARANCE AGREEMENT

This SIXTH AMENDMENT TO FINANCING AGREEMENT AND FORBEARANCE AGREEMENT, dated as of December 15, 2020 (this “Amendment”), is entered into by and among Apex Global Brands Inc. (formerly known as Cherokee Inc.), a Delaware corporation (the “Parent” and the “U.S. Borrower”), Irene Acquisition Company B.V., a private company with limited liability incorporated under the laws of the Netherlands, having its statutory seat (statutaire zetel) in Amsterdam, the Netherlands and registered with the Dutch trade register under number 67160921 (the “Dutch Borrower” and, together with the U.S. Borrower, each a “Borrower” and collectively, the “Borrowers”), each Guarantor party hereto, the Lenders party hereto which constitute all of the Lenders party to the Financing Agreement as of the date hereof, Callodine Commercial Finance,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company (as successor to Gordon Brothers Finance Company, a Delaware corporation) (“Callodine”), as collateral agent for the Lenders (in such capacity, together with its successors and assigns in such capacity, the “Collateral Agent”), and Callodine, as administrative agent for the Lenders (in such capacity, together with its successors and assigns in such capacity, the “Administrative Agent” and together with the Collateral Agent, each an “Agent” and collectively, the “Agents”).

W I T N E S S E T H:

WHEREAS, the Parent, the Borrowers, the Guarantors, the lenders from time to time party thereto (collectively, the “Lenders” and each individually, a “Lender”) and the Agents are parties to that certain Financing Agreement, dated as of August 3, 2018 (as amended by that certain First Amendment to Financing Agreement, dated as of December 28, 2018, as further amended by that certain Second Amendment to Financing Agreement, dated as of January 29, 2019, as further amended by that certain Third Amendment to Financing Agreement and Forbearance Agreement, dated as of December 20, 2019, as further amended by that certain Fourth Amendment to Financing Agreement and Forbearance Agreement, dated as of April 30, 2020 (the “Fourth Amendment”), as further amended by that certain Fifth Amendment to Financing Agreement and Forbearance Agreement, dated as of September 1, 2020 (the “Fifth Amendment”) and as further amended, modified or otherwise supplemented from time to time prior to the date hereof, the “Financing Agreement”);

WHEREAS, (x) Events of Default have occurred and are continuing under the Financing Agreement pursuant to (i) Section 9.01(c) of the Financing Agreement as a result of the Borrowers breach of Section 7.03(b) of the Financing Agreement for the period ended October 31, 2019 and January 31, 2020 and (ii) Section 9.01(c) of the Financing Agreement as a result of the Borrowers breach of Section 7.03(c) of the Financing Agreement (collectively, the “Financing Agreement Events of Default”) and (y) an Event of Default has occurred under the Fifth Amendment pursuant to Section 2(c) of the Fifth Amendment Fee Letter (the “Forbearance Event of Default” and, together with the Financing Agreement Events of Default, collectively, the “Existing Events of Default”).


WHEREAS, as a result of the Forbearance Event of Default, a Termination Event under (and as defined in) the Fifth Amendment has occurred.

WHEREAS, as a result of the Existing Events of Default and the Termination Event under (and as defined in) the Fifth Amendment, the Secured Parties have certain rights and remedies under the terms of the Financing Agreement and the other Loan Documents as well as applicable law, including, without limitation, the right to (a) declare that all Obligations are immediately due and payable; (b) declare that all outstanding Obligations accrue interest at the Post-Default Rate; and (c) exercise any other rights and remedies afforded under any Loan Document or by law, at equity or otherwise;

WHEREAS, the Borrowers have requested the Agents and Lenders forbear from exercising the Agents’ rights and remedies granted pursuant to the Financing Agreement and other Loan Documents in order to provide the Borrowers an opportunity to consider various business alternatives.  The Agents and Lenders have agreed to forbear from exercising their rights and remedies solely in accordance with the terms and conditions of this Amendment; and

WHEREAS, the Borrowers have requested that the Agents and the Lenders effect certain amendments to the Financing Agreement, in each case, as more specifically set forth herein, and the Agents and the Lenders are willing, as applicable, to effect such amendments to the Financing Agreement, in each case, on the terms and conditions hereinafter set forth.

N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the foregoing and the mutual covenants herein contained, and for other good and valuable consideration, the receipt and sufficiency of which are hereby acknowledged, it is hereby agreed by and between the Agents, the Lenders, the Borrowers and the Guarantors, as follows:

4.Acknowledgment of Indebtedness.  Each Loan Party acknowledges and agrees that, as of December 14, 2020, the Loan Parties are indebted, jointly and severally, (a) to the Tranche A Term Loan Lenders for the Tranche A Term Loans in an aggregate outstanding principal amount equal to $ $4,957,263.88 plus accrued and unpaid interest thereon, as provided in the Financing Agreement and the other Loan Documents, $1,238,759.62 of which is payable to Callodine Commercial Finance SPV, LLC (f/k/a Gordon Brothers Finance Company, LLC), $1,277,633.93 of which is payable to Gordon Brothers Brands, LLC and $2,440,870.33 of which is payable 1903 Partners, LLC; (b) the Tranche B Term Loan Lenders for the Tranche B Term Loans in an aggregate outstanding principal amount equal to $34,700,847.25 plus accrued and unpaid interest thereon, as provided in the Financing Agreement and the other Loan Documents, $8,671,317.37 of which is payable to Callodine Commercial Finance SPV, LLC, $8,943,437.61 of which is payable to Gordon Brothers Brands, LLC and $17,086,092.27 of which is payable 1903 Partners, LLC; (c) the Tranche C Term Loan Lenders for the Tranche C Term Loans in an aggregate


outstanding principal amount equal to $841,820.01 plus accrued and unpaid interest thereon, as provided in the Financing Agreement and the other Loan Documents; (d) the Tranche D Term Loan Lenders for the Tranche D Term Loans in an aggregate outstanding principal amount equal to $5,050,920.00 plus accrued and unpaid interest thereon, as provided in the Financing Agreement and the other Loan Documents and (e) for accrued and unpaid fees and expenses of Agents and Lenders (and any other amounts due under the Financing Agreement and the other Loan Documents, including but not limited to reasonable fees and disbursements of counsel).

5.Acknowledgment of Existence of Events of Default.  Each Loan Party acknowledges and agrees that the Existing Events of Default have occurred and are continuing.  Each Loan Party acknowledges and agrees that the Agents and the Lenders have not waived the Existing Events of Default or any other Event of Default.  Each Loan Party further acknowledges and agrees that, as a result of the occurrence of the Existing Events of Default: (a) all of such Loan Party’s obligations, liabilities and indebtedness to the Agents and the Lenders under the Financing Agreement and the other Loan Documents may at any time, subject to the terms of this Amendment, the Financing Agreement and the other Loan Documents, be declared due and payable in full, (b) the Agents and the Lenders have no further commitment to extend credit to the Borrowers and (c) the Agents and the Lenders, subject to the terms of this Amendment, are entitled to proceed to enforce any and all of their rights and remedies under the terms of the Financing Agreement and the other Loan Documents.

8.Covenants and Agreements.  Without any prejudice or impairment whatsoever to any of the rights and remedies of the Agents or any Lender contained in the Financing Agreement or any of the other Loan Documents or in any agreement, document or instrument executed in connection therewith, each of the Loan Party’s covenants and agrees with the Agents and the Lenders that so long as the Existing Events of Default have not been waived by the Required Lenders (it being understood and agreed that, unless otherwise explicitly set forth herein, the terms of this Section 8 shall survive the termination of the Forbearance Period so long as the Existing Events of Default are continuing):

a.Approved Budget.  The Borrowers have delivered to the Agents on December 14, 2020 a weekly budget March 31, 2021, prepared by the Administrative Borrower, which budget shall include information on a line item basis as to (w) projected cash receipts, (x) projected disbursements (including ordinary course operating expenses, capital expenditures, asset sales, credit party expenses and any other fees and expenses relating to the Loan Documents), (y) a calculation of the Borrowing Base and (z) the amount of Qualified Cash, which shall be in form and substance acceptable to the Agents (the “Approved Budget”) and each such Approved Budget to be consistent with past practice.  At all times during the Forbearance Period, the Borrowers shall deliver to the Agents on or before 2:00 p.m. (Boston time) on Friday (or, if such day is not a Business Day, on the next succeeding Business Day) an updated Approved Budget for the thirteen (13) week period commencing as of the Sunday of such week, in form and substance satisfactory to the Agents (it being understood that each subsequent Approved Budget shall only add projections for the last week of the thirteen (13) week period covered thereby and shall not modify any prior periods, and no such updated, modified or supplemented budget shall be effective until so approved by the Agents and only once so approved by the Agents shall it be deemed an “Approved Budget”).

b.Budget Variance Report.  The Loan Parties shall continue to comply with the Budget Variance Report obligations set forth in the Fifth Amendment and, as such, on or before 2:00 p.m. (Boston time) on Friday of each week, the Borrowers shall deliver to the Agents a Budget Variance Report.  As used herein “Budget Variance Report” means a weekly report provided by the Borrowers to the Agents, showing amount of Qualified Cash as of Saturday of each week and the actual receipts and disbursements for each line item compared to the Approved Budget, as applicable, on a cumulative basis from the date hereof of until the fourth (4th) week after the date hereof and then on a rolling four (4) week basis at all times thereafter, noting therein all variances, on a line-item basis, from amounts set forth for such period in the Approved Budget, and shall include or be accompanied by explanations for all material variances and certified by an Authorized Officer of the Parent.

c.[Reserved].

d.Modified Principal and Interest Payments During the Forbearance Period.  During the Forbearance Period (as hereinafter defined) only and subject to the provisions of Section 8(h) hereof:  (i) the U.S. Borrower and the Dutch Borrower, as applicable, shall not be required to make the regularly scheduled cash amortization payments on the Tranche A Term Loans or the Tranche B Term Loans pursuant to Section 2.03(a) and (b) of the Financing Agreement, (ii) (x) interest in respect of the Loans which accrues on the Loans held by Callodine Commercial Finance SPV, LLC and its successors and assigns shall be paid in cash on the


applicable interest payment date at a rate per annum equal to the LIBOR Rate plus 7.95% (it being understood and agreed that the LIBOR Rate will be no less than 2.00% as set forth in the definition of “LIBOR Rate”) and (y) all other interest (including the balance of the interest in respect of the Loans which accrues on the Loans held by Callodine Commercial Finance SPV, LLC and its successors and assigns) shall be automatically paid-in-kind on the applicable interest payment date by capitalizing and adding such amounts to the principal amount of the applicable Loans on which such interest accrued (the interest under this clause (y), the “Capitalized Interest”) and (iii) the Loans shall not accrue interest at the Post-Default Rate.  The Capitalized Interest shall be treated as principal of the applicable Loans on which such interest accrued for all purposes of the Loan Documents and thereafter bear interest as provided in Section 2.04 of the Financing Agreement.  For the avoidance of doubt, (i) this Section 8(d) only modifies the Financing Agreement as explicitly set forth herein, (ii) after the Initial Tax Refunds (as hereinafter defined) and Subsequent Tax Refunds (as hereinafter defined) in an aggregate amount of at least $4,900,000 have been received by the Loan Parties (which are required to be applied to the Obligations in accordance with the provisions of Section 8(h) hereof), clauses (i) and (ii) in the first sentence of this Section 8(d) shall no longer apply and all of the payment and repayment provisions in the Financing Agreement with respect thereto shall govern, and (iii) after the Forbearance Period ends (but subject to the provisions of Section 8(h) hereof), this Section 8(d) shall no longer apply and all of the payment and repayment provisions in the Financing Agreement with respect thereto shall govern.

e.Consolidated EBITDA Definition.  During the Forbearance Period only, Section 1.01 of the Financing Agreement shall be amended by deleting “$750,000” in sub-clause (ix) of the definition of “Consolidated EBITDA” and inserting “$1,200,000.00” in lieu thereof.

f.Qualified Cash.  During the Forbearance Period only, Section 7.03(a) of the Financing Agreement shall be amended by deleting “$700,000” and inserting “$100,000.00” in lieu thereof.

g.Consolidated EBITDA.  During the Forbearance Period only, Section 7.03(b) of the Financing Agreement shall be amended by deleting “$9,500,000” where it appears opposite “January 31, 2020 and thereafter” and inserting “$6,500,000” in lieu thereof.

h.Application of Tax Refunds.  The Loan Parties shall promptly (and in any event within five (5) Business Days of receipt thereof), use the proceeds of any tax (or similar) refund received by the Loan Parties from the IRS or any other Governmental Authority with respect to the Loan Parties’ tax return(s) relating to the 2018 or 2019 Fiscal Year as follows:

i.With respect to any Initial Tax Refunds (as hereinafter defined), (x) 30% of the proceeds of such Initial Tax Refunds may be retained by the Loan Parties for working capital and other general corporate purposes; and (y) 70% of the proceeds of such Initial Tax Refunds shall repay the Obligations as follows:  (A) first, to any Capitalized Interest that has accrued on the Tranche A Term Loan and Tranche B Term Loan (on a pro rata basis between the Tranche A Term Loan and the Tranche B Term Loan) and to any “Payables” due to Callodine Commercial Finance, LLC (successor to Gordon Brothers Finance Company) pursuant to that


certain amended and restated letter agreement, dated as of September 1, 2020 (as may be amended), by and among, among others, the Parent and Gordon Brothers Finance Company (as assigned by Gordon Brothers Finance Company to Callodine Commercial Finance, LLC, pursuant to that certain assignment letter agreement, dated as of December [__], 2020, the “Payable Letter”), until such amounts under this clause have been paid in full, (B) second, to any Capitalized Interest that has accrued on the Tranche C Term Loan and Tranche D Term Loan (on a pro rata basis between the Tranche C Term Loan and the Tranche D Term Loan) but only to the extent of such Capitalized Interest which would not have been capitalized but for the provisions of Section 8(d) hereof, the provisions of Section 8(d) of the Fifth Amendment, and the provisions of Section 8(d) of the Fourth Amendment until such Capitalized Interest has been paid in full, (C) third, towards the regularly scheduled cash amortization payments on the Tranche A Term Loans and the Tranche B Term Loans which were required to be paid on May 1, 2020 pursuant to Section 2.03(a) and (b) of the Financing Agreement (on a pro rata basis between the Tranche A Term Loan and the Tranche B Term Loan) but for the provisions of Section 8(d) of the Fourth Amendment until such principal payments have been paid in full, (D) fourth, towards the regularly scheduled cash amortization payments on the Tranche A Term Loans and the Tranche B Term Loans required to be paid on November 1, 2020 pursuant to Section 2.03(a) and (b) of the Financing Agreement (on a pro rata basis between the Tranche A Term Loan and the Tranche B Term Loan) but for the provisions of Section 8(d) of the Fifth Amendment until such principal payments have been paid in full, (E) fifth, to the extent not previously paid, towards the regularly scheduled cash amortization payments on the Tranche A Term Loans and the Tranche B Term Loans required to be paid on February 1, 2021 pursuant to Section 2.03(a) and (b) of the Financing Agreement (on a pro rata basis between the Tranche A Term Loan and the Tranche B Term Loan) but for the provisions of Section 8(d) of this Amendment until such principal payments have been paid in full, and (F) sixth, in the manner provided in Section 2.05(d) of the Financing Agreement.  For purposes hereof, the “Initial Tax Refunds” shall mean all tax or similar refunds received by the Loan Parties from the IRS or other Governmental Authority up to an aggregate amount of $2,400,000.

ii.With respect to any other refunds received by the Loan Parties from the IRS or other Governmental Authority after the Initial Tax Refunds (each a “Subsequent Tax Refund”), (x) 40% of the proceeds of each such Subsequent Tax Refund may be retained by the Loan Parties for working capital and other general corporate purposes and (y) 60% of the proceeds of each such Subsequent Tax Refund shall repay the Obligations, in either case under this clause (y), as follows: (A) first, to any Capitalized Interest that has accrued on the Tranche A Term Loan and the Tranche B Term Loan (on a pro rata basis between the Tranche A Term Loan and the Tranche B Term Loan) and to any “Payables” due to Callodine Commercial Finance, LLC (successor to Gordon Brothers Finance Company) pursuant to the Payable Letter, until such amounts under this clause have been paid in full, (B) second, to any Capitalized Interest that has accrued on the Tranche C Term Loan and the Tranche D Term Loan (on a pro rata basis between the


Tranche C Term Loan and the Tranche D Term Loan) but only to the extent of such Capitalized Interest which would not have been capitalized but for the provisions of Section 8(d) hereof, the provisions of Section 8(d) of the Fifth Amendment, and the provisions of Section 8(d) of the Fourth Amendment until such Capitalized Interest has been paid in full, (C) third, towards the regularly scheduled cash amortization payments on the Tranche A Term Loans and the Tranche B Term Loans required to be paid on May 1, 2020 pursuant to Section 2.03(a) and (b) of the Financing Agreement (on a pro rata basis between the Tranche A Term Loan and the Tranche B Term Loan) but for the provisions of Section 8(d) of the Fourth Amendment until such principal payments have been paid in full, (D) fourth, towards the regularly scheduled cash amortization payments on the Tranche A Term Loans and the Tranche B Term Loans required to be paid on November 1, 2020 pursuant to Section 2.03(a) and (b) of the Financing Agreement (on a pro rata basis between the Tranche A Term Loan and the Tranche B Term Loan) but for the provisions of Section 8(d) of the Fifth Amendment until such principal payments have been paid in full, (E) fifth, to the extent not previously paid, towards the regularly scheduled cash amortization payments on the Tranche A Term Loans and the Tranche B Term Loans required to be paid on February 1, 2021 pursuant to Section 2.03(a) and (b) of the Financing Agreement (on a pro rata basis between the Tranche A Term Loan and the Tranche B Term Loan) but for the provisions of Section 8(d) of this Amendment until such principal payments have been paid in full, and (G) sixth, in the manner provided in Section 2.05(d) of the Financing Agreement.  Once the Initial Tax Refunds and Subsequent Tax Refunds received aggregate to at least $4,900,000, the provisions in clauses (i) and (ii) of the first sentence in Section 8(d) hereof shall no longer be applicable.

Any payments of the Obligations made pursuant to this Section 8(h) shall not be subject to the Applicable Premium.  Notwithstanding the foregoing, if the Administrative Agent, Collateral Agent, or Required Lenders, as applicable, have elected to apportion the payments as set forth in, and in accordance with the terms of, Section 4.03(b) of the Financing Agreement, then the provisions of such Section 4.03(b) shall control.  The provisions of this Section 8(h) amend and restate the provisions of Section 8(h) of the Fifth Amendment in their entirety and Section 8(h) of the Fifth Amendment shall be superseded by this Section 8(h).  All references to Section 8(h) of the Fifth Amendment in any Loan Document or other document or instrument delivered in connection therewith shall be deemed to refer to this Section 8(h) and the provisions hereof.

i.Board Observer.  Each Loan Party will continue to permit the Agents to have a representative (the “Board Observer”) present (whether in person or by telephone) in an observer capacity at all duly convened meetings of the Board of Directors or managers of each Loan Party and any committee meetings thereof.  The Board Observer must be approved by the U.S. Borrower (such approval not to be unreasonably withheld, conditioned or delayed).  Each Loan Party shall provide the Board Observer representative with a notice and agenda of each duly convened meeting of the Board of Directors and any committee thereof at least seven (7) days (or such lesser time as agreed to by the Board Observer) in advance of such meeting, and all of the information and other materials that are distributed to the Board of Directors or any committee thereof, as applicable, at the same time and in the same manner as such notices, agendas, information and other materials are provided to the members of the Board of Directors or any


committee thereof; provided, however, that the Loan Parties reserve the right to withhold any information and to exclude the Board Observer from any meeting or portion thereof if (x) access to such information or attendance at such meeting would, upon advice of the Loan Parties’ counsel, adversely affect the attorney-client privilege between the Loan Parties and their counsel or (y) in the reasonable judgment of the Loan Parties, access to such information or attendance at such meeting could result in a conflict of interest between the Secured Parties and the Loan Parties.  The Loan Parties shall reimburse the Board Observer for the reasonable out-of-pocket expenses (including travel expenses) incurred by the Board Observer in connection with the Board Observer attending any meetings of the Board of Directors or any committees thereof.  The Parent shall hold at least one meeting of its Board of Directors each month.

j.Tax Returns.  The Loan Parties shall (i)  deliver to the Administrative Agent and the Lenders copies of all written correspondence sent to or received from the IRS related to the Loan Parties’ 2018 and 2019 Fiscal Year federal tax filings (including, without limitation, any such correspondence related to the anticipated tax (or similar) refunds related thereto) together with each weekly Budget Variance Report delivered by the Loan Parties and (ii) use their best efforts to collect any and all anticipated tax (or similar) refunds in respect of the Loan Parties’ 2018 and 2019 Fiscal Year tax filings from the IRS or other applicable Governmental Authority as soon as possible.  Additionally, the Loan Parties shall notify the Administrative Agent and the Lenders of any conversations (including telephonic conversations), and describe the substance of such conversations, that a representative of the Loan Parties has with a representative of the IRS related to the Loan Parties’ 2018 and 2019 Fiscal Year federal tax filings together with each weekly Budget Variance Report delivered by the Loan Parties.  With respect to any state tax filings and solely to the extent requested by any Agent or any Lender, the Loan Parties shall (i) promptly deliver to the Administrative Agent and the Lenders copies of all written correspondence sent to or received from the applicable Governmental Authority related to the Loan Parties’ 2018 and 2019 Fiscal Year state tax filings (including, without limitation, any such correspondence related to the anticipated tax (or similar) refunds related thereto) and (ii) notify the Administrative Agent and the Lenders of any conversations (including telephonic conversations), and describe the substance of such conversations, that a representative of the Loan Parties has with a representative of the applicable Governmental Authority related to the Loan Parties’ 2018 and 2019 Fiscal Year state tax filings, in each case, together with each weekly Budget Variance Report delivered by the Loan Parties.


9.Forbearance by Agents and Lenders.  In consideration of the Loan Parties performance in accordance with this Amendment (including, without limitation, the requirement of the Loan Parties to perform their obligations under the Financing Agreement (as hereby amended), the other Loan Documents, the Fee Letter, and the Fifth Amendment Fee Letter), the Agents and Lenders shall forbear from enforcing their rights and remedies under the Financing Agreement and other Loan Documents until the earlier of (i) December 31, 2020 at 5:00 p.m. (Boston time); provided, however, if a Purchase Agreement (as defined in the Fifth Amendment Fee Letter) is executed and delivered to the Agents and the Lenders on or before December 31, 2020 in accordance with the terms of the Fifth Amendment Fee Letter, then such date shall be extended to March 1, 2021 at 5:00 p.m. (Boston time); provided, further, however, if the Sale Closing Extension Event under (and as defined in) the Fifth Amendment Fee Letter has occurred, such date shall be further extended to March 31, 2021 at 5:00 p.m. (Boston time) (the then-applicable date under this clause (i), the “Termination Date) or (ii) the occurrence of a Termination Event (the period from the Fifth Amendment Effective Date until the earlier to occur of the Termination Date and the occurrence of a Termination Event, the “Forbearance Period”).  Notwithstanding the foregoing:
